Re-Colored transforms discarded materials into wearable art. Founded by Abdulkerim, the brand turns discarded plastic bags into bold and creative designs through circular and sustainable production.

Rooted in creativity and conscious design, Re-Colored is creating local impact by encouraging communities to see value in overlooked materials while growing its presence on the global stage. Each piece reflects resilience, innovation, and a vision for a more sustainable fashion future.

Through the Creative DNA programme by the British Council, creatives and entrepreneurs like Abdulkerim are connecting, collaborating, and amplifying African innovation globally.

QENA AFRIKA celebrates alignment, unity, and contemporary African identity. Founded by Amanuel Atle, the brand draws inspiration from everyday Ethiopian life — its culture, colours, and energy — bringing them into modern design through thoughtful and sustainable production.

Rooted in creativity and cultural expression, QENA AFRIKA represents a new generation of fashion that blends authenticity, innovation, and contemporary African storytelling while growing its presence on the global stage.

Through the Creative DNA programme by the British Council, creatives and entrepreneurs like Amanuel are connecting, collaborating, and amplifying African innovation globally.

40% of learners globally are taught in languages they do not fully understand.

This is not just a language issue - it is a learning crisis.

Our new position paper explores how language-responsive education can close this gap and improve outcomes.
